单片机 中 IT0=1; EX0=0 是什么意思,用在什么时候

发布网友 发布时间:2022-04-26 10:58

我来回答

3个回答

热心网友 时间:2022-06-20 11:55

51单片机的IT0位是控制外部中断0的触发方式的。

外部中断0触发方式控制位,1表示边沿触发,0表示电平触发。

如果IT0设置为0,则外部中断0引脚被拉至低电平即可引发外部中断。

如果IT0设置为1,则外部中断0引脚需要检测到下降沿才能引发外部中断。

EX0是外部中断0的使能控制位,如果EX0设置为0,则外部中断0失效,无论外部中断引脚如何变化,都不会发生外部中断。

扩展资料:

单片机中断系统的作用——

不同的计算机其硬件结构和软件指令是不完全相同的,因此,中断系统也是不相同的。计算机的中断系统能够加强CPU对多任务事件的处理能力。

中断机制是现代计算机系统中的基础设施之一,它在系统中起着通信网络作用,以协调系统对各种外部事件的响应和处理。

中断是实现多道程序设计的必要条件。 中断是CPU对系统发生的某个事件作出的一种反应。 引起中断的事件称为中断源。

中断源向CPU提出处理的请求称为中断请求。发生中断时被打断程序的暂停点称为断点。CPU暂停现行程序而转为响应中断请求的过程称为中断响应。

处理中断源的程序称为中断处理程序。CPU执行有关的中断处理程序称为中断处理。而返回断点的过程称为中断返回。中断的实现实行软件和硬件综合完成,硬件部分叫做硬件装置,软件部分称为软件处理程序。

热心网友 时间:2022-06-20 11:56

  51单片机的IT0位是控制外部中断0的触发方式的,如果IT0设置为0,则外部中断0引脚被拉至低电平即可引发外部中断;如果IT0设置为1,则外部中断0引脚需要检测到下降沿才能引发外部中断。

  EX0是外部中断0的使能控制位,如果EX0设置为0,则外部中断0失效,无论外部中断引脚如何变化,都不会发生外部中断。

  具体信息请参阅STC官方提供的DataSheet文档(附件)。想要掌握一种器件的话,最好的方法就是直接阅读官方提供的DataSheet文档。

热心网友 时间:2022-06-20 11:56

开完就等中断,当然不理啦,中断服务程序会处理

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com